Abstract
"MéTODO E SISTEMA DE RáDIO DE TRANSMITIR UM SINAL DIGITAL" A invenção se refere a um método e um sistema de rádio para transmitir um sinal digital. O método compreende as seguintes etapas: (300) transmitir pelo transmissor pelo menos uma parte do sinal através de pelo menos duas trajetórias de antena transmissora diferentes; (302) ponderar pelo transmissor a potência de transmissão dos sinais a serem transmitidos através das trajetórias de antena transmissora diferentes, um em relação ao outro, por intermédio de coeficientes de ponderação variáveis determinados para cada trajetória de antena transmissora; (304) receber o sinal pelo receptor. Numa realização, (306) o receptor executa medições nos sinais recebidos que foram transmitidos através das diferentes trajetórias de antena transmissora; (308) o receptor sinaliza para o transmissor dos dados de coeficiente de ponderação formados em função das medições; (312A) o transmissor forma coeficientes de ponderação por intermédio da sinalização de dados de coeficiente de ponderação. Numa outra realização, (310) o transmissor forma um valor de qualidade para a sinalização de dados de coeficiente de ponderação que recebeu; (312B) o transmissor forma coeficientes de ponderação por intermédio do valor de qualidade da sinalização de dados de coeficiente de ponderação e da própria sinalização.
